André Borschberg

Co-Founder & Executive Chairman at H55

André Borschberg is a seasoned entrepreneur and pilot, currently serving as Co-Founder and Executive Chairman of H55 since 2017, where André utilizes extensive experience gained over 30 years in the aerospace industry and within the Solar Impulse project. As a key leader of the Solar Impulse initiative alongside Bertrand Piccard, Borschberg successfully transformed the vision of a solar-powered airplane into reality, achieving historic milestones including the first round-the-world solar flight in 2016. Additionally, Borschberg is an accomplished professional speaker, sharing insights on innovation and leadership. Their background includes roles as a pilot in the Swiss Air Force, a consultant at McKinsey & Company, and participation in the World Presidents' Organization, along with a strong academic foundation with master's degrees in Management Science from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ology and Mechanical Engineering from EPFL.
